William D. Wilson is a lawyer practicing real estate, state, local and municipal law, estate planning and 2 other areas of law. William received a B.S. degree from University of Miami in 1966, and has been licensed for 54 years. William practices at Wilson, Thompson & Cisek, L.L.C. in Franklin, PA.
